Transaction 0421de3499ef4b85eaade7993fa0392a011a454697823d8e51e3be371d992246

22 Input
1 Outputs
  • 0421de3499ef4b85eaade7993fa0392a011a454697823d8e51e3be371d992246:0
  • value  974100
    address  1F6EwDNXgxWRB4dxVkZg46BsWuGXa3h2nD